Add a peppery zing to your salads and sandwiches with easy-to-grow Arugula (Eruca sativa)! 🥬 Also known as rocket or roquette, this leafy green is a fast-growing, cool-season vegetable with deeply lobed leaves and a bold, spicy flavor loved by chefs and gardeners alike.
Key Information:
-
Latin Name: Eruca sativa
-
Plant Type: Annual leafy green
-
Seed Count: 100 seeds
-
Plant Height: 8–12 inches (20–30 cm)
-
Spread: 6–10 inches (15–25 cm)
-
Hardiness Zones: USDA 3–11
-
Sun Requirements: Full sun to partial shade
-
Soil Type: Well-drained, fertile soil; pH 6.0–7.0
-
Sowing Time:
-
Outdoors: Early spring or late summer for fall harvest
-
Indoors: 4–6 weeks before last frost
-
-
Germination Time: 5–10 days
-
Days to Harvest: 20–40 days
-
Watering Needs: Keep soil consistently moist; do not let dry out
-
Spacing: 2–4 inches apart in rows 10–12 inches apart
-
Harvesting: Begin harvesting baby leaves as early as 3 inches tall; cut-and-come-again method works well
Usage:
-
Culinary: Arugula’s bold, peppery flavor enhances salads, pizzas, sandwiches, pasta dishes, pestos, and more. Best used fresh, but can also be lightly sautéed or blended into sauces.
-
Nutritional Value: Rich in vitamins A, C, and K, calcium, iron, and antioxidants
-
Ornamental: Adds visual interest to vegetable gardens with its unique leaf shape
-
Companion Plants: Grows well with lettuce, spinach, carrots, beets
-
Container Friendly: Ideal for raised beds, pots, and window boxes
Pro Tips:
-
Plant successively every 2–3 weeks for a continuous harvest
-
Shade during hot weather to prevent bolting
-
Attracts few pests and is quick to mature, making it perfect for beginner gardeners
